Handle Stains Immediately and Correctly

Red wine, grass, or makeup smudges need swift attention. Use a clean, white cloth to blot—never rub—stains to prevent spreading. Think of it like dabbing hot oil from a pan; gentle touches are key. For stubborn spots, consult a professional rather than risking set-in stains from home remedies. Professionals use targeted stain removal techniques, comparable to a restorer delicately removing rust from antiques.

Ensure Proper Storage Post-Cleaning

Once cleaned, your gown must be stored correctly to maintain its beauty over the years. Store it in a breathable, acid-free container or a preservation box designed for wedding gowns. Avoid plastic bags that trap moisture, which can cause yellowing and fabric deterioration. For long-term preservation, consider museum-quality solutions, but verify their authenticity to avoid fake preservation claims—see museum-quality preservation. When I stored my sister’s gown in a proper archival box, it appeared nearly new after five years, free of yellowing or fabric stress.

The Secret to Long-Lasting Bridal Gown Care

Keeping your wedding gown in pristine condition over the years demands more than just professional cleaning; it requires the right tools and a little know-how. As someone who has managed both delicate fabrics and high-end embellishments, I can attest that investing in quality equipment and understanding precise methods makes all the difference. First, a professional-grade steamer is indispensable—it gently removes wrinkles without risking damage, unlike traditional ironing which can flatten delicate beadwork or lace. I personally rely on the Polti Vaporella, a trusted choice among Tampa Bay’s gown care experts, for its ability to produce continuous, low-pressure steam that safely revitalizes fabrics.

Next, having a good handheld beadboard or gentle brush helps in delicate spot cleaning. For example, soft-bristled brushes from brands like BareMinerals are my go-to—they effectively lift surface dust and loose fibers before or after cleaning, preserving the gown’s intricate details. It’s also essential to use pH-neutral fabric cleaners tailored for wedding dresses; professionals often recommend eco-friendly solutions, which are not only gentle but also better for the environment and the fabric’s longevity. I’ve adopted the use of Orvus paste, a mild, archival-quality cleaner proven to preserve delicate textiles, as you might find detailed in technical fabric restoration guidelines.

When it comes to storage, acid-free tissue paper and archival-quality garment bags are non-negotiable. Proper storage prevents yellowing and fabric stress, which can be a common pitfall for DIY preservation attempts.
